Forced-Air Furnaces
Forced-air furnaces are the most common type of heating installed in North America. A natural gas furnace heats your home via the combustion of fuel, ignition by an electric shock, and set of burners that heats the heat exchanger. Air is forced around the heat exchanger and through the ducts to heat your home.

HEPA Filtration Systems
HEPA filtration filters air with a series of three filters. The pre-filter collects the largest particles, the carbon/charcoal filter catches the odors, and the third filter is the certified HEPA filter that collects particles down to 0.3 microns. The HEPA Filtration removes mold spores, dust mites, pollen, smoke, animal dander and much more. Keep your family healthy and comfortable with HEPA Filtration.

Whole-House Bypass Humidifiers
Heating your home dries out your air. The air absorbs moisture from you and everything inside your home. Low-humidity air can cause skin irritation and discomfort, wall and ceiling cracks, and makes you feel colder. Viruses also thrive in low humidity environments increasing the likelihood of getting colds and flus. Be more comfortable and save energy in your home with a whole-house humidifier.
